Uranium GZUX 165.3SQ by Ground Zero

Uranium GZUX 165.3SQ is a Crossover from Ground Zero. Designed as a passive variable 3-way crossover. High and midrange levels are selectable in 3 stages. Semi-active operation is possible. Gold-plated connections. Slope steepness 12 dB/octave. High-pass filter 4500 Hz at 12 dB/octave, bandpass with high-pass 450 Hz and low-pass 4500 Hz at 12 dB/octave, low-pass filter 450 Hz at 12 dB/octave. Power handling 160 Watts RMS. Delivered as 1 pair (2 pieces).

How does the neodymium magnet in the Uranium ZUF 60SQ-A affect sound quality?

The neodymium magnet in the Uranium ZUF 60SQ-A is a crucial factor for sound quality. Neodymium is a very strong and lightweight material that generates a high magnetic field strength. This improves the efficiency of the speaker by allowing precise control of diaphragm movement. Additionally, the small size and high power of the neodymium magnet save weight, contributing to the overall efficiency of the speaker. As a result, the neodymium magnet ensures clear, powerful, and distortion-free sound.

What installation tips are there for the Ground Zero Uranium GZUX 165.3SQ Crossover?

When installing the Ground Zero Uranium GZUX 165.3SQ, the placement should be chosen to protect it from external influences. The Crossover should be mounted near the speakers to minimize signal loss. This means keeping the corresponding cable paths short and carefully connecting the gold-plated terminals. Mounting in the trunk or under the seats is advisable depending on the vehicle. Consider the size compatibility with your vehicle regarding the dimensions of the Crossover to find an ideal installation location and achieve the best sound quality.
